Models of the CLV and RM effect of the Na I D1 line for a Sunlike star orbited by a Jupiter-sized planet at b = 0. The upper panel is the CLV effect-only, and the middle panel combines the CLV with the RM effect for a slow-rotator like the Sun. Finally, the bottom panel shows the two effects for a fast-rotator, that is a Sun-like star with a rotational velocity of 10 km s−1.
